Output 3123a6985ea8f2a723072429438dc59ff2df19ac5c24409cd077e1c452beef52:0

value
3620581
script pubkey
OP_0 OP_PUSHBYTES_20 b65df3c3cc3180d02cdb0bd17010db2beb2c9581
address
tb1qkewl8s7vxxqdqtxmp0ghqyxm904je9vpy4f4qa
transaction
3123a6985ea8f2a723072429438dc59ff2df19ac5c24409cd077e1c452beef52